New for 2025: MSc Public Policy

Are you looking for a career in public policy or do you want to take your policy career to the next level? This course provides you with a global understanding of policy-making processes and skills in data analysis for evidence-based policy making, combined with the opportunity to gain hands-on experience to enhance your employability.
From the economy and the environment to education, migration, healthcare and beyond, today’s policy makers face a multitude of complex challenges. Our custom-designed MSc in Public Policy critically examines global policy concerns, exploring the reasons why decisions are made and how these decisions impact different areas of society.
Covering all aspects of the policy process from agenda setting to evaluation, the curriculum has been developed to equip you with the skills to examine diverse policy issues, make evidence-driven decisions, and evaluate their success or failure. Whether you are looking for a role with an NGO or government, or simply looking to advance your private sector role with a cutting-edge ability to evaluate how policy decisions will shape your industry, this course gives you the skills to advance your career.
